asp.net如何让gridview只显示含有某个值的行

2024-11-15 18:17:15
推荐回答(2个)
回答(1):

方法有很多,第一种、你用手动绑定GridView。在查询出来的数据进行检索,比如你查询出来的是DataTable,你可以循环进行判断里面是否有你所保存的session["userid"]人的信息,没有直接删除了,在你显示的时候就显示剩下的。
第二种方法、把session["userid"]拼接成语句直接到数据库里面查询有这个人的,select * from 表 where userId(数据库字段名)=你传进来的值
建议你用第二种。

回答(2):

直接在数据源中加个条件啊,where userid=‘“+session["userid"]+"'"